Kawardha Assembly Election Result 2013

Chhattisgarh ·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 2013

Ashok Sahu of Bharatiya Janata Party won the Kawardha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Chhattisgarh in the 2013 state assembly election, securing 93,645 votes (44.50% vote share). The runner-up was Akbar Bhai (Indian National Congress) with 91,087 votes.

A total of 11 candidates contested this assembly seat. Position Candidate Name Votes Votes% Party
1 Ashok Sahu 93645 44.50% Bharatiya Janata Party
2 Akbar Bhai 91087 43.30% Indian National Congress
3 Kartik Ram Marar 6859 3.30% Chattisgarh Swabhiman Manch
4 Malesh Kumar Markam 5151 2.50% Gondvana Gantantra Party
5 Mohit Sahu 3829 1.80% Independent
6 Kanhaiya Lal Patel 3157 1.50% Bahujan Samaj Party
7 Anil Satnami 2858 1.40% Independent
8 Jitendra Kumar Purainak 1610 0.80% Independent
9 Himanshu Thakur 1098 0.50% Akhil Bhartiya Gondwana Party
10 Niranjan Khare 704 0.30% Bharatiya Dalit Congress
11 Krishna Kumar Dahire 554 0.30% National People's Party
